New Representations of Matroids and Generalizations

We extend the notion of matroid representations by matrices over fields and consider new representations of matroids by matrices over finite semirings, more precisely over the boolean and the superboolean semirings. This idea of representations is generalized naturally to include also hereditary collections. We show that a matroid that can be directly decomposed as matroids, each of which is representable over a field, has a boolean representation, and more generally that any arbitrary hereditary collection is superboolean-representable.
